    8, CECIL COURT, BARNET, EN5 4NX

    This semi-detached freehold property on Cecil Court last sold in September 2017 for £550,000. Based on price growth in the EN5 district since then, its estimated current value is £650,003 — placing it in the 88th percentile nationally and the 55th percentile within EN5. The property covers 85 m² (915 sq ft), giving an estimated value of £7,647 per m². The EPC rating is D, with a potential rating of B.
